Data Science Manager – Sports Pricing
PrizePicks
• Own pricing and risk strategy for our fantasy markets, balancing competitiveness and profitability. • Lead and grow a high-performing team of pricing analysts and data scientists. • Oversee development and deployment of pricing models across major sports and esports (NBA, NFL, CS2, etc). • Partner cross-functionally with Product, Engineering, and BizOps to launch and optimize pricing initiatives. • Guide experimentation around payout structures, hold targets, and win rate optimization to drive engagement and margin. • Maintain and evolve frameworks for pricing accuracy, risk exposure monitoring, and market health. • Ensure data integrity and modeling quality across all pricing efforts.
Job Requirements
- 5+ years of experience in sports betting, fantasy, or related gaming industries, ideally with exposure to pricing, trading, or risk management.
- Strong technical foundation in data science, statistics, or software engineering.
- Demonstrated management experience — leading, mentoring, and scaling high-output teams.
- Proficiency in SQL and Python or R; experience with simulation-based modeling and statistical optimization techniques.
- Deep understanding of how sports and/or esports markets are structured and modeled.
- Proven track record of driving complex projects from ideation through launch in a fast-paced environment.
- Strong communicator who thrives at the intersection of data, product, and operations.
